Q: How to Service and Repair a Front Parking Brake Cable on 2004 Dodge Durango?
A: Before you work on the front parking brake cable, raise the car, secure it, then lock the parking brake cable. Unscrew loosen adjusting nut 1 to give yourself some movement in the front cable and then pull out the front cable from the cable connector. Fold in the end connector of the cable against the first underbody bracket and disconnect cable 2 from that bracket. Raise the vehicle and push the small ball end of the cable out of the pedal clevis, using a screwdriver. Fit the end of cable 2 onto fitting 2 at the pedal bracket and then pull out cable 1. After removing the left cowl trim and sill plate, take up the carpet and also remove the cable from the body clip. Use cable 2 to pull the wrap up the pole and remove it with body grommet 1. Place cable fitting 2 into hole #2 in pedal assembly 1 from inside the car, put cable retainer in pedal assembly and join the cable ball end to the clevis on the assembly. Pass Route cable 2 via the flooring, secure body grommet 1 underneath, lay down the carpet and then refit the left cowl trim and sill plate. Raise and support the vehicle again, feed the cable through bracket 1 and fit the cable end into this bracket. Plug the cable into the connector, make the park brake adjustment and then bring the vehicle down.
